## Text Indent Property
|
|
|
|
The `text-indent` css property specifies the amount of indentation (empty space) that is put before lines of text in a block. By default, this controls the indentation of only the first formatted line of the block, but the `hanging` and `each-line` keywords can be used to change this behavior.
|
|
|
|
**Keywords**
|
|
|
|
`hanging` - Indentation affects the first line of the block container as well as each line after a forced line break, but does not affect lines after a soft wrap break.
|
|
|
|
`each-line` - Inverts which lines are indented. All lines except the first line will be indented.
|
|
|
|
**Syntax**
|
|
|
|
```css
|
|
/* <length> values */
|
|
text-indent: 40px;
|
|
|
|
/* <percentage> value relative to the containing block width */
|
|
text-indent: 10%;
|
|
|
|
/* Keyword values */
|
|
text-indent: 2em each-line;
|
|
text-indent: 2em hanging;
|
|
text-indent: 2em hanging each-line;
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
_Note: currently support for keywords `hanging` and `each-line` is only available behind the Experimental Web Platform features flag_
